The reference bible for old bikes of this era, particularly German ones, is the Encyclopaedia by Erwin Tragatsch, who listed every last one of them (allegedly). The Bolbros is not listed, and I haven`t heard of it either, and I`m pretty sad when it comes to knowing about old bikes like this. My guess is that the plaque was added by the owner, but it`s not the make of the bike. There were any number of companies in the 50`s in Germany making small utility 2 strokes, usually using engines from Kreidler, Sachs, Viktoria, EMC, Adler, DKW etc
